You may have heard the buzz about the portfolio framework special session at SOCAP11. If you missed it, the session was a presentation from Leslie Christian, CEO of Portfolio 21 Investments and Don Shaffer, President & CEO of RSF Social Finance on a white paper released the same day. The paper, A New Foundation for Portfolio Management, questions many of the assumptions that current investment practice takes for granted and asserts the need to expand our fundamental understanding of risk, growth, and utility to meet the investment challenges of the 21st century.
It is Don and Leslie’s hope that the principles put forth in the paper will ignite conversations in the investment community. The paper is available on the RSF Social Finance website.
